LSU Computer Based Testing: Ultimate Guide to Online Exams & Prep

LSU computer based testing modernizes how students take exams, aligning with digital learning trends and campus technology initiatives. This approach reduces scheduling friction and delivers faster score turnaround for administrators and test takers alike.

Online exam platforms support secure authentication, timed assessments, and instant grading for many question types, simplifying the testing workflow at Louisiana State University. The following sections outline key implementation areas, user experiences, and practical guidance.

Understanding LSU Computer Based Testing Infrastructure

The LSU computer based testing infrastructure standardizes hardware, network bandwidth, and software compatibility across campus testing centers. IT staff coordinate with academic departments to ensure that operating systems, browsers, and required plugins remain up to date before each exam window.

Infrastructure Components

  • Centralized authentication using university credentials
  • Redundant internet connections in proctored rooms
  • Device image management for consistent performance
  • Monitoring dashboards for real time issue detection

Exam Scheduling And Room Allocation

Using a unified scheduling interface, instructors book computer based testing rooms, select seating configurations, and specify resource needs such as specialized software or adaptive technology. The system prioritizes equitable room distribution while minimizing conflicts between departments.

Scheduling Best Practices

  • Confirm student enrollment numbers before setting room capacity
  • Reserve backup rooms in case of technical issues
  • Align exam times with campus wide network peak management
  • Publish clear instructions for room changes or cancellations

Security And Integrity Policies

LSU computer based testing security policies outline authentication steps, permissible software, and incident response procedures. These measures protect assessment validity and ensure compliance with accreditation requirements and state regulations.

Key Security Layers

  • Multi factor login and session timeouts
  • Browser lockdown tools to prevent navigation
  • Recorded session logs for audit trails
  • Plagiarism and similarity checks where applicable

Student Experience And Accessibility

Students access LSU computer based testing through familiar campus labs or designated remote environments, with clear guidance on device requirements and connectivity. Accessibility options such as extended time, screen readers, and alternative input methods are coordinated through disability services in advance of each exam.

Preparing for a Computer Based Exam

  • Verify device compatibility and install required software early
  • Complete a practice session to review navigation and timing
  • Confirm quiet testing space and reliable internet connection
  • Contact support channels as soon as issues arise

FAQ

Reader questions

How do I access the LSU computer based testing portal from off campus?

Use your university VPN with your campus credentials, then navigate to the designated exam portal link. Ensure that your device meets the system requirements listed in the course syllabus.

What should I do if my connection drops during an online exam?

Immediately reconnect using the same session link and notify the proctor or instructor through the platform chat. Most systems preserve time remaining so your progress is not lost.

Are accommodations automatically applied during computer based testing?

You must confirm approved accommodations with disability services before the exam window. Once verified, the testing platform applies time limits and settings per your authorized support plan.

Can I change my exam time after the schedule is published?

Schedule changes are only permitted through the official change window and require approval from your department and the testing coordinator. Late requests may result in reassignment to the next available slot.
